Cranberry Bars with Cream Cheese Frosting

  • 4

Ingredients

  • FROSTING:
  • 3/4 cup butter, softened
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 3/4 cup Daisy Brand® Sour Cream
  • 1/2 teaspoon almond ext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up white baking chips
  • 1 cup dried cranberries
  • 1/2 cup chopped walnuts
  • 2 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up butter, softened
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ups confectioners' sugar
  • 1/2 cup dried cranberries, chopped

Preparation

Step 1

1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Gradually beat in eggs, sour cream and extracts. In a small bowl, whisk flour, baking powder and salt; gradually beat into creamed mixture. Fold in baking chips, cranberries and walnuts. Spread into a 15x10x1-in. baking pan coated with cooking spray.
2. Bake 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ool completely in pan on a wire rack.
3. For frosting, in a small bowl, beat cream cheese, butter and vanilla until smooth. Beat in confectioners' sugar; spread over top. Sprinkle with cranberries. Cut into bars or triangles. Refrigerate leftovers.
